Output 691ca33e3211530ecd76701acbadb4e7dbd060d127f8cd93489b865a2e5fbe65:0

value
608940373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7bc5c7088994df86d7e800415662b30a3827ddd OP_EQUAL
address
3QGvUV2PfHxfuwZKkvA5KEXAf1sNWUVSP6
transaction
691ca33e3211530ecd76701acbadb4e7dbd060d127f8cd93489b865a2e5fbe65
spent
true